数控机床怎样编写程序

数控机床编写程序的基本步骤如下:

1. 确定加工零件的几何形状和加工工艺:首先需要确定待加工零件的几何形状和加工工艺,包括切削轴线、切削点、切削速度等参数。

2. 选择数控编程方式:根据机床的不同类型和品牌,选择适合的数控编程方式,包括直线插补、圆弧插补等。

3. 设定坐标系原点和工件坐标系:确定机床上安装的坐标系原点和工件坐标系。

4. 设置参考点和测量工具:设置数控机床上的参考点或测量工具,用于校正位置偏差。

5. 编写数控程序:使用数控编程语言,根据加工零件的几何形状和加工工艺,编写数控程序。常用的数控编程语言有G代码和M代码。

6. 调试和验证程序:将编写完成的数控程序加载到数控机床控制系统中,并进行调试和验证。可以通过模拟加工或试切等方式来检查程序的正确性和加工效果。

需要注意的是,数控机床编程需要掌握一定的机械加工和数控技术知识,熟悉数控编程语言和机床操作规范,对加工工艺和切削参数有一定的了解。在实际操作中,还需要根据具体的加工任务和机床设备的要求,进行适当的调整和优化编程。

版权申明:财旺号所有作品(图文、音视频)均由用户自行上传分享,仅供网友学习交流,不声明或保证其内容的正确性,如发现本站有涉嫌抄袭侵权/违法违规的内容。请发送邮件至 1790309299@qq.com 举报,一经查实,本站将立刻删除。

(0)
小二的头像小二

相关推荐

  • MySQL中索引的分类及特点

    MySQL中的索引可以根据其特点和应用的方式进行分类。常见的索引分类包括:主键索引、唯一索引、普通索引、全文索引和复合索引。 1. 主键索引(Primary Key Index):主键索引用于标识并保证表中每一行数据的唯一性。主键索引的特点是它的键值不能重复且不能为空,因此,一个表不能有多个主键索引。主键索引的优点是查询速度快,因为它使用了索引的唯一性来引导…

    2023年12月5日
    00
  • python如何用if语句

    在Python中,if语句用于根据条件来控制程序的执行流程。if语句的基本语法如下: if condition: # code block to be executed if condition is True else: # code block to be executed if condition is False 其中,`condition`是一个表…

    2024年3月8日
    00
  • 怎么用cmd查电脑系统信息

    要使用cmd来查看电脑的系统信息,可以按照以下步骤进行操作: 1. 打开命令提示符:在Windows系统中,可以通过按下Win + R键,在弹出的运行窗口中输入”cmd”并按下回车键来打开命令提示符。 2. 输入系统信息命令:在命令提示符中,输入以下命令之一,然后按下回车键来获取不同的系统信息: – systeminfo:…

    2024年1月11日
    00
  • 执行java程序的命令

    执行Java程序的命令一般是使用`java`命令。下面是使用`java`命令执行Java程序的详细说明: 1. 编译Java源代码文件(.java文件)成字节码文件(.class文件):使用`javac`命令来执行此操作。命令格式为:`javac <filename>.java`。 2. 执行已编译的Java程序:使用`java`命令来执行此操作…

    2024年2月1日
    00
  • python列表索引超出范围怎么解决

    当你尝试访问一个索引超出范围的Python列表时,Python会引发一个IndexError异常。要解决这个问题,你可以采取以下措施: 1.确保索引值在列表范围内:在索引列表元素之前,使用条件语句(如if语句)来检查索引是否超过列表长度。 if index < len(my_list): # 执行相应的操作 else: # 处理索引超出范围的情况 2.使用t…

    2023年12月26日
    00

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注